Vue.js是一款流行的JavaScript框架,用于构建用户界面。升级Vue.js版本是一个常见的需求,因为新版本通常会带来更好的性能、更多的功能和更好的开发体验。我们将讨论如何升级Vue.js版本以及可能遇到的一些问题和解决方案。

## 为什么升级Vue.js版本?
升级Vue.js版本有几个主要原因:
1. **性能改进**:新版本通常会引入一些性能优化,例如更快的渲染速度和更小的包大小,从而提高应用程序的整体性能。
2. **功能增强**:新版本可能会引入一些新的功能,例如更好的响应式系统、更灵活的组件选项和更强大的工具集,使开发者能够更轻松地构建复杂的应用程序。
3. **Bug修复**:新版本通常会修复一些已知的Bug,提高应用程序的稳定性和可靠性。
4. **社区支持**:随着时间的推移,社区对新版本的支持会逐渐增加,这意味着你可以更容易地找到相关的文档、教程和解决方案。
## 如何升级Vue.js版本?
升级Vue.js版本可以分为以下几个步骤:
1. **备份项目**:在进行任何升级之前,务必备份项目的源代码和相关配置文件。这样可以在升级过程中出现问题时恢复到之前的状态。
2. **查看官方文档**:在Vue.js官方文档中查找有关升级的指南和建议。官方文档通常提供了详细的说明和步骤,帮助你顺利完成升级过程。
3. **更新Vue.js依赖**:在项目的package.json文件中,将Vue.js的版本号更新为最新版本。然后使用包管理工具(如npm或yarn)安装更新后的依赖。
4. **解决冲突和问题**:在升级过程中,可能会出现一些冲突和问题。例如,新版本可能引入了一些不兼容的更改,导致应用程序无法正常工作。解决这些问题可能需要修改代码、更新依赖或使用其他解决方案。
5. **测试和验证**:在完成升级后,务必对应用程序进行全面的测试和验证,确保所有功能都正常工作并且没有引入新的Bug。
## 低成本升级Vue.js版本的解决方案
升级Vue.js版本可能会涉及一些成本,例如修改代码、解决冲突和重新测试应用程序。为了降低成本,可以考虑以下几个解决方案:
1. **逐步升级**:将升级过程分为多个较小的步骤,逐步更新Vue.js的版本。这样可以更容易地解决冲突和问题,并减少对现有代码的影响。
2. **使用升级工具**:有一些工具可以帮助自动化升级过程,例如Vue CLI提供了一些插件和命令,可以帮助你自动更新Vue.js版本并解决一些常见的问题。
3. **参考社区资源**:在升级过程中,可以参考社区中其他开发者的经验和解决方案。例如,可以查找相关的博客文章、论坛帖子和GitHub存储库,以了解其他人在升级过程中遇到的问题和解决方法。
升级Vue.js版本是一个重要的任务,可以带来许多好处。通过遵循官方文档的指南,解决冲突和问题,并采取一些低成本的解决方案,可以使升级过程更加顺利和高效。记得在升级之前进行备份,并在升级后进行全面的测试和验证,以确保应用程序的稳定性和可靠性。

京公网安备 11010802030320号